Understanding Economic Nexus Requirements for IT Companies in the USA

The economic nexus rules establish which conditions require businesses to collect and pay sales tax in states where they lack physical operations. IT companies that offer software subscriptions and cloud services or digital solutions create nexus connections through their transactions and revenue streams.

Companies can achieve compliance with their state obligations by conducting regular threshold monitoring which helps them avoid penalties. Multi-State Payroll Compliance Management

Remote teams working for technology companies operate from multiple states. Each location requires businesses to complete payroll tax registration and reporting obligations for their employees.

Paying employees requires businesses to maintain payroll compliance by monitoring employee residency rules and employer tax obligations and state withholding requirements. The absence of structured payroll workflows results in compliance errors which affect both employees and the organization.

Software and Digital Services Sales Tax Management

States have different rules for how they apply sales tax to software and digital services. Some jurisdictions tax software-as-a-service subscriptions while others choose to exempt specific digital products. The business needs to closely monitor taxability regulations because this practice ensures they meet state requirements while decreasing the chances of facing unexpected costs during audits.
